Phthalates Affect Way Young Boys Play
“Mothers exposed to high levels of chemicals known as phthalates during pregnancy may have boys who are less likely to play with trucks and other male-typical toys or to play fight, according to a new study.””

Child Food Allergies on the Rise in U.S.
“Pediatric food allergies, which can sometimes be life-threatening, are increasing at a dramatic rate in the United States, new research shows.”

Statins do not eliminate risk of low HDL-cholesterol levels
“Low levels of HDL cholesterol, even among statin-treated patients, are associated with a significantly increased risk of cardiovascular disease, particularly the risk of MI, a new study has shown.”
